Bitcoin at a Critical Turning Point: Is the next move towards 130000$?

$BTC is once again approaching a major inflection point, and historical price action may offer important clues about what comes next.
Examining the weekly chart reveals a recurring pattern that has appeared throughout previous Bitcoin market cycles. Each cycle has generally followed three stages:
Accumulation
After a major correction, Bitcoin spends months building a base. During this period, volatility contracts, market sentiment remains uncertain, and long-term participants quietly accumulate positions.
Expansion
Once accumulation is complete, Bitcoin enters a strong trending phase. Higher highs and higher lows develop inside a rising structure, attracting increasing participation from retail and institutional investors.
Final Rally and Distribution
Historically, Bitcoin has often experienced a final acceleration toward the upper boundary of its long-term trend channel. This stage typically produces extreme optimism before a larger corrective phase begins.
What Is Happening Right Now?
The current chart suggests Bitcoin is testing one of the most important support areas of the cycle.
The blue demand zone around $58,000-$60,000 represents an area where buyers have previously stepped in to absorb selling pressure.
As long as this support remains intact, the broader bullish structure remains valid.
The recent pullback should therefore be viewed as a test of market strength rather than an automatic signal that the bull cycle has ended.
Bullish Outlook
If support holds, Bitcoin could continue following the historical trajectory shown on the chart.
Potential targets include:
$80,000 resistance recovery$100,000 psychological level$120,000 resistance region$125,000-$130,000 upper channel target
This would represent the final expansion phase similar to previous cycle behavior.
Bearish Outlook
No analysis is complete without considering downside risk.
If Bitcoin loses the $58,000 support region and fails to reclaim it quickly, market structure could weaken significantly.
Possible consequences include:
Increased volatilityDeeper liquidity huntsExtended consolidation periodDelayed cycle top formation
This scenario would not necessarily end the long-term bull market, but it could postpone the next major rally.
Key Levels to Watch
Support$58,000-$60,000Resistance
$65,000
$80,000
$100,000
Long-Term Target
$125000-130000$
Final Thoughts
Bitcoin is approaching a decisive moment. The current support zone could determine whether the market proceeds toward a new cycle high or enters a deeper consolidation phase.
History does not repeat perfectly, but it often rhymes. The structure visible on the weekly chart closely resembles previous cycle developments, making the coming weeks especially important for traders and investors.
Always remember that technical analysis provides probabilities, not guarantees. Proper risk management remains the most important tool in any market environment.

BTC Down 2.86% Today — Here Is Why the Bigger Picture Still Holds
A two-and-a-half percent drawdown on $BTC in a single trading session feels uncomfortable when you are staring at the screen. According to CoinMarketCap, Bitcoin sits at $60,958.28 as of this writing, with a 24-hour trading volume of $1.06 billion and a market capitalization of $1.22 trillion. The number is red, the candles are shortening, and the instinct is to react. But the disciplined investor asks a different question: does today's move change the thesis, or does it confirm the cycle?

Let us take the long view first.

Bitcoin has traded above the $60,000 level for the better part of recent months, consolidating after a powerful multi-year advance. Pullbacks of two to five percent in a single day are not anomalies — they are the texture of every bull cycle that has ever existed. The 2017 run had multiple sessions where Bitcoin shed five percent before pushing to new highs. The 2020-2021 cycle had corrections of 20 percent mid-trend that, in hindsight, were entry points, not exits. A 2.86% daily decline on volume of $1.06 billion is volatility, not a regime change.

Now anchor that context to what is actually happening in the broader ecosystem today.

The CBOE just debuted a prediction market offering S&P 500 contracts. This matters for Bitcoin because it deepens the infrastructure of speculative and hedging instruments that institutional capital relies on. The more mature the derivatives landscape becomes across all asset classes, the more natural it is for allocators to include digital assets alongside equities and commodities. CBOE expanding its product suite is a rising-tide signal for the entire risk-asset complex, including $BTC.

Meanwhile, Binance is reportedly exploring alternative EU licensing routes if its Greek regulatory bid fails. Regulatory navigation is messy, and headlines like this can spook short-term traders. But zoom out. The fact that the world's largest exchange is actively pursuing compliant pathways across multiple European jurisdictions — rather than retreating — tells you everything about where institutional demand is heading. Compliance friction is the cost of mainstream adoption. Every major financial institution that exists today passed through years of regulatory uncertainty before becoming household names.

On the security front, SecondFi has traced a Cardano wallet exploit to an address-level vulnerability. Exploits in the broader crypto space periodically inject fear into the market, and $BTC often feels the spillover as capital temporarily retreats to the sidelines. But Bitcoin's security model remains unmatched. No chain has demonstrated a comparable track record of uptime and attack resistance over a 15-plus-year period. These incidents in adjacent ecosystems are reminders of why Bitcoin's simplicity is a feature, not a limitation.

Perhaps the most substantive headline for near-term risk assessment is the CryptoQuant warning regarding Strategy's dividend coverage as its cash reserves have reportedly fallen 38 percent. This is worth monitoring. Corporate treasury strategies involving Bitcoin carry leverage risk, and when a major holder faces cash-flow pressure, the market rightly prices in the possibility of forced selling. This is not a reason to abandon the thesis, but it is a reason to be honest about near-term downside. If institutional holders with concentrated positions face liquidity crunches, the $BTC order book will absorb pressure over sessions that feel worse than they are.

The notable movers in today's market — BAS up 36.3%, LAB up 23.3%, and O up 17.8% according to CoinMarketCap — underscore that risk appetite has not vanished. Capital is rotating, not fleeing. That distinction matters enormously. In true bear phases, everything sells off in unison. When you see double-digit gains on altcoin pairs while Bitcoin consolidates, you are watching a market that is repricing, not collapsing.

Here is the patient takeaway. Near-term risk for $BTC exists in the form of corporate treasury fragility, regulatory noise, and the occasional exploit-driven sentiment shock. These are real, and dismissing them is not conviction — it is negligence. But none of them touch the fundamental demand drivers: fixed supply, growing institutional infrastructure, and a global monetary environment that continues to favor hard assets over dilutable ones.

Volatility is the price of admission. The question is not whether there will be red days — there will be many — but whether the structural trajectory over the next several years remains intact. On that front, the evidence points clearly toward yes.

When you look at your portfolio after a session like this, are you evaluating the price or the thesis?

Think in cycles, not candles.

The more I look at Pixels, the less I see a loose play-to-earn farm... and the more I see a very disciplined game economy hiding inside a Web3 shell. That is the part people miss. Pixels openly says it wants sustainability, wants to learn from leading Web2 games, and moved away from the inflation-heavy $BERRY model to build a tighter economy around $PIXEL and off-chain Coins. That alone changes the whole reading of the game. This is not just about token rewards anymore. It is about control. Rhythm. Retention. Economy management.

What really caught me was VIP. On the surface, it looks simple. A monthly membership. Extra backpack slots. Reputation points. VIP lounge energy. More task board access. VIP-only tasks. Better marketplace convenience. But when I step back, it starts to feel like more than a perk system. It feels like a quiet sorting machine. A way to tell who is passing through... and who is actually willing to stay, spend, and build inside the world. Almost like Pixels is using monetization the way a city uses gates, roads, and toll booths. Not to stop movement entirely. Just to shape it.

That is why I think this matters. In Pixels, spending does not just buy comfort. It can improve your position inside the economy. The Task Board is the only in-game route to earn $PIXEL , and better odds can come from VIP or land ownership. Reputation also decides who can withdraw, trade, use the marketplace, or create a guild. So no... access is not fully flat here. It is layered. Carefully. Intentionally. And honestly, that makes Pixels feel less like a token faucet and more like a live-service game with real monetization discipline. In this market, that may be one of its smartest moves yet.
